Abstract: | Volumes have been written on Malta’s role during World War II, of its gallant defenders and brave people, the Royal Navy’s vital role, the Royal Air Force and the three famous biplane fighters, the Gloster Gladiators Faith, Hope and Charity, the numerous army regiments stationed in Malta, and especially the gunners of the Royal Artillery, the Royal Marines and the Royal Malta Artillery. |
